Vinci Hydrogen chamber valve (VCH)
Mass 11.5 kg
Fluid compatibility GH2, GHe, GN2
Maximal pressure 90 bar
ESEOD 65 mm
Flow rate 7 kg/s (GH2)
The Hydrogen Chamber Valve is integrated into the Vinci engine of the Ariane 6 upper stage. This normally closed pneumatic poppet valve is located upstream from the combustion chamber and its purpose is to control the gaseous hydrogen supply to the engine combustion chamber.

Design, development, assembly & testing of flow regulation valves for space launcher engines and stages.
Safran Aero Boosters specializes in flow regulation valves for space propulsion. With a strong focus on Research and Technology, the company is a partner on most future European launcher propulsion programs. Safran Aero Boosters’s equipment is developed under extreme conditions of temperature, pressure, vibration and flow and has demonstrated 100% reliability over 45 years. The company is able to hardness this high-level expertise to provide flow regulation valves (pneumatic/electric – linear/rotative) for most of propulsion systems on launchers.
